AI in Physical Security Market Outlook 2034: Trends, Growth & Key Insights
Modern physical security setups are shifting away from traditional analog systems and perimeter fencing toward interconnected environments that combine computer vision, behavioral analytics, and automated incident response. By integrating artificial intelligence directly into cameras, access control hardware, and cloud networks, security teams can process massive amounts of visual and operational data in real time. This eliminates reliance on manual video monitoring, minimizes costly false alarms, and significantly shortens emergency response times across both private and public sector facilities.
The AI in physical security market was valued at US$ 5.82 Billion in 2025 and is projected to reach US$ 13.86 Billion by 2034, registering a CAGR of 11.46% during 2026–2034.
Key Drivers
Rising Demand for Real-Time Threat Detection and Automation
Traditional security infrastructure relies heavily on human operators to review live feeds or past footage, leaving systems vulnerable to delayed responses and human fatigue. AI-powered video analytics and automated intrusion detection address these challenges by instantly detecting anomalies, weapon threats, tailgating, and unauthorized boundary breaches. The ability to trigger real-time alerts automatically empowers security personnel to mitigate threats before escalation occurs.
Smart City Infrastructure and Public Safety Mandates
Governments around the globe are heavily investing in smart city projects, intelligent transportation hubs, and modern public safety infrastructure. Incorporating AI-driven visual surveillance systems across traffic networks, public transit centers, and municipal borders enables city managers to monitor urban movement, handle crowd management, and safeguard public infrastructure efficiently.
Expansion of High-Security Environments and Data Centers
The exponential growth of data center facilities, critical energy infrastructure, and enterprise corporate campuses has elevated physical perimeter defense to a top business priority. Facilities holding sensitive digital assets require physical access security solutions, including AI biometrics, behavioral access controls, and automated tailgating detection systems.
Market Opportunities
- Predictive Threat Modeling: Leveraging historical intrusion data and machine learning allows systems to identify security vulnerabilities, forecast potential risk points, and optimize guard deployment schedules.
- Convergence of Cyber and Physical Security: Unifying physical security assets (access logs, video feeds) with IT network monitoring platforms opens major opportunities to detect combined cyber-physical security breaches.
- Autonomous Aerial and Ground Patrols: Integrating AI-driven drone surveillance and mobile autonomous security robots offers continuous, hands-free perimeter monitoring for vast industrial complexes, logistics hubs, and military installations.
Market Segmentation
By Type
- Solutions: Includes AI software modules, smart video analytics engines, and hardware equipped with edge-processing chips.
- Services: Encompasses professional integration, system maintenance, and managed security service provider (MSSP) operations.
By Technology
- Computer Vision: Enables real-time object tracking, facial recognition, and license plate reading.
- Machine Learning: Powers continuous model training and pattern learning to identify operational anomalies.
- Context-Aware Computing: Evaluates environmental cues and multi-sensor inputs to lower false alert instances.
- Natural Language Processing: Allows voice-activated security controls, incident reporting, and audio threat detection.
By Deployment
- On-Premise: Favored by high-security government, defense, and industrial facilities requiring local data containment.
- Cloud: Growing rapidly among commercial enterprises due to lower initial capital expenditure and remote management accessibility.
By Industry End User
- Commercial: Data centers, financial institutions, retail facilities, and office buildings.
- Military & Defense: Border control operations, national defense perimeter monitoring, and government installations.
- Manufacturing & Industrial: Warehouse tracking, production asset protection, and workplace safety compliance monitoring.
- Residential: Smart home ecosystems, gated community access control, and automated neighborhood monitoring.
Market News and Recent Developments
Industry leaders are advancing technology through strategic acquisitions, cloud migrations, and specialized AI launches:
- Autonomous AI Agents: The deployment of AI-powered virtual security agents capable of running remote guard operations, performing threat verifications, and communicating directly with site visitors has accelerated automated physical defense.
- Edge System Integrations: Security providers are increasingly partnering with specialized system integrators to roll out AI-enabled cameras and IoT access control modules across corporate facilities.
- Privacy Compliance Adapters: Companies operating in European and North American territories are developing targeted privacy masks and automated data anonymization tools to comply with stringent local regulatory requirements, including the EU AI Act.
Competitive Landscape Analysis & Top Players
The market exhibits a competitive environment populated by established security equipment manufacturers, software developers, and cloud providers. Strategic moves center around edge computing innovations, sensor fusion integration, and expanding software-as-a-service (SaaS) business models.
Key Industry Players
- Axis Communications AB
- Bosch Building Technologies
- Honeywell International Inc.
- Hikvision Digital Technology Co., Ltd.
- Dahua Technology Co., Ltd.
- Hanwha Vision
- Johnson Controls International plc
- Motorola Solutions, Inc. (Avigilon)
- Verkada Inc.
- Eagle Eye Networks
Leading hardware vendors differentiate themselves by embedding custom neural processing units directly onto camera SoCs, while cloud-native operators capture enterprise market share through central access dashboards and low-friction remote setup.
Future Outlook
Looking toward 2034, the physical security sector will transition toward fully autonomous security operations. System intelligence will extend beyond passive recording into proactive environment management, where AI engines coordinate perimeter doors, public announcements, lighting systems, and security dispatch teams simultaneously. As low-power edge chips lower hardware costs and cloud deployment frameworks simplify multi-site management, AI technology will move from a premium add-on to the baseline operational standard across global physical security solutions.
